The GRV bar that shows up in the UI while you pilot a ship indicates the Grav Drive Gauge. It lets you know how much power you are sending to the grav drive ship module so that you can perform a grav jump.

When you fill up the bar and allocate more power to the GRV gauge, it makes your grav jump launch quicker as shown by the 4 red bars on screen. This makes it a lot easier to escape unfavorable ship battles since you cannot fast travel while in combat.
Do note that adding more power does not make your grav jumps go farther, and you only need one bar to grav jump.

Grav Jumping is how the player travels to other star systems with their ship. You can grav jump by opening up the map menu, zooming out, and selecting a star system you want to go to. If you have not traveled to the star system, or you are in combat, then a 'Jump' button appears to begin the grav jump sequence.
